Visuino bridges the gap between hardware and software by representing physical electronic components, sensors, and coding logic as visual blocks. Instead of typing lines of code, you connect these blocks with lines to map out how data flows. When you are finished, Visuino automatically translates your visual map into standard Arduino C++ code and uploads it. 🛠️ How it Works: The 4 Step Workflow Pick Your Board
